The president of Turkish Defence Industries, ?smail Demir, revealed the brand new Aselsan AESA radar on 10 November, saying the system might be retrofitted onto the Turkish Air Pressure’s (TuAF’s) F-16 Combating Falcon fighter plane and Akinci unmanned aerial car (UAV), in addition to the longer term Turkish Fighter Experimental (TF-X)/Nationwide Fight Plane (MMU). Turkey’s Aselsan has created a brand new lively electronically scanned array (AESA) radar as a part of OZGUR venture that goals to modernize Turkey’s Lockheed Martin F-16 Block 30 fleet. Turkey owns 270 F-16C/Ds, however the OZGUR modernization will solely cowl 35 Block 30 plane.
Aselsan’s Murad AESA radar makes use of the newest Gallium Nitride (GaN) expertise. This multifunctional radar is able to simultaneous air-to-air, air-to-ground, air-to-sea missions and has digital assault capabilities. An lively electronically scanned array (AESA) is a kind of phased array antenna, which is a computer-controlled array antenna wherein the beam of radio waves may be electronically steered to level in numerous instructions with out shifting the antenna. Within the AESA, every antenna ingredient is related to a small solid-state transmit/obtain module (TRM) underneath the management of a pc, which performs the features of a transmitter and/or receiver for the antenna.

The Turkish Air Pressure’s has 174 F-16C and 58 F-16D plane in its stock. The F-16 is the mainstay of the TuAF’s front-line fight aviation drive, with the single-seat C and twin-seat D fashions having been in near-continuous upgrades since their introduction within the late Nineteen Eighties. The improve contains extending the F-16’s flight hours from 8,000 hours to 12,000 hours — and avionics modernization. The modernization features a new mission laptop, a system interface unit, new cockpit coloration shows, hydraulic gas gauge, engine show display, new nationwide identification buddy/foe system, new radar warning receivers, and an inertial navigation system.
